Tabla de contenido:
- Paso 1: mira el video
- Paso 2: Obtén todas las cosas
- Paso 3: Estudie el diagrama del circuito
- Paso 4: Ensamble el circuito en una placa y pruébelo
- Paso 5: haz una versión permanente
- Paso 6: Pruébelo con un microcontrolador, cargue el código Arduino
- Paso 7: Realice las conexiones de cableado
- Paso 8: Encienda la configuración
- Paso 9: Expanda más
Video: Utilice un motor paso a paso como codificador rotatorio: 9 pasos (con imágenes)
2024 Autor: John Day | [email protected]. Última modificación: 2024-01-30 08:40
Los codificadores rotativos son excelentes para su uso en proyectos de microcontroladores como dispositivo de entrada, pero su rendimiento no es muy fluido y satisfactorio. Además, teniendo muchos motores paso a paso de repuesto, decidí darles un propósito. Entonces, si tiene algunos motores paso a paso por ahí y quiere hacer algo, obtenga los suministros y ¡comencemos!
Paso 1: mira el video
Paso 2: Obtén todas las cosas
Para este proyecto, necesitará:
- Un motor paso a paso (unipolar o bipolar).
- Un chip de amplificador operacional LM358P.
- Una resistencia de 1k Ohm.
- 2x resistencias de 100k Ohm.
- 2x resistencias de 4.7k Ohm.
- 2x resistencias de 47k Ohm.
- Un LED.
- Conexión de cables.
Componentes opcionales:
- 2x LED
- 2x resistencias de 330 ohmios
Paso 3: Estudie el diagrama del circuito
¡Gracias, Andriyf1!
Asegúrese de revisar el esquema del circuito antes de continuar.
Dado que los dos pines en el medio del encabezado que se conectarán al motor paso a paso están conectados al mismo punto en el circuito (digamos, común), puede usar un encabezado 1x3 en lugar del encabezado 1x4 en la versión permanente, pero luego Para conectar un motor paso a paso bipolar, deberá conectar un cable de las dos bobinas cada una y conectarlos al punto común del circuito con los dos cables restantes que se conectarán a los pines P y S respectivamente.
Paso 4: Ensamble el circuito en una placa y pruébelo
Comience colocando la nave del amplificador operacional en la placa y continúe conectando resistencias en las ubicaciones apropiadas. Intente utilizar cables más cortos y evite enredarlos. Asegúrese de que no haya conexiones sueltas y de que se realicen de acuerdo con el esquema del circuito.
Conecte el motor paso a paso al amplificador y enciéndalo con una fuente de alimentación de 5 voltios.
Si está utilizando los LED opcionales, conecte el ánodo de cada LED a cada una de las salidas a través de una resistencia de 330 Ohm y conecte sus cátodos a 'GND'.
Paso 5: haz una versión permanente
Haga clic en la imagen para saber más.
Se recomendará hacer una versión permanente del amplificador, ya que será más compacto y práctico de usar en proyectos.
Paso 6: Pruébelo con un microcontrolador, cargue el código Arduino
Este ejemplo controla el brillo de un LED conectado al pin 'D13' ajustando el ciclo de trabajo en ese pin de salida, controlado por un codificador rotatorio.
Paso 7: Realice las conexiones de cableado
Conecte la potencia del amplificador al pin * '+ 5-V,' -ve 'al pin' GND 'y los pines de salida a los pines' D6 'y' D7 'de la placa Arduino. La secuencia de la conexión de los pines de salida del amplificador a los pines de entrada del Arduino determina si la dirección particular de movimiento del motor paso a paso se registrará en sentido horario o antihorario.
* Si está utilizando un microcontrolador que funciona en un nivel lógico de 3.3 V, asegúrese de alimentar el amplificador solo con 3.3 V CC
Paso 8: Encienda la configuración
Conecte la instalación a una fuente de alimentación adecuada (5-12 voltios CC) y enciéndalo.
Paso 9: Expanda más
Ahora que lo tienes funcionando, puedes hacer todo tipo de proyectos que se pueden hacer con un codificador rotatorio. Si hace algo con él, intente compartir algunas imágenes de su trabajo con la comunidad haciendo clic en '¡Lo hice!'.
Recomendado:
Motor paso a paso controlado por motor paso a paso sin microcontrolador: 6 pasos
¡Motor paso a paso controlado por motor paso a paso sin microcontrolador !: En este Instructable rápido, haremos un controlador de motor paso a paso simple usando un motor paso a paso. Este proyecto no requiere circuitos complejos ni un microcontrolador. Así que sin más preámbulos, ¡comencemos
Motor paso a paso controlado por motor paso a paso sin microcontrolador (V2): 9 pasos (con imágenes)
Motor paso a paso controlado por motor paso a paso sin microcontrolador (V2): En uno de mis Instructables anteriores, le mostré cómo controlar un motor paso a paso usando un motor paso a paso sin un microcontrolador. Fue un proyecto rápido y divertido, pero vino con dos problemas que se resolverán en este Instructable. Entonces, ingenio
Modelo de locomotora controlada por motor paso a paso - Motor paso a paso como codificador rotatorio: 11 pasos (con imágenes)
Locomotora modelo controlada por motor paso a paso | Motor paso a paso como codificador rotatorio: en uno de los Instructables anteriores, aprendimos cómo usar un motor paso a paso como codificador rotatorio. En este proyecto, ahora usaremos ese motor paso a paso convertido en codificador rotatorio para controlar un modelo de locomotora usando un microcontrolador Arduino. Entonces, sin fu
Motor paso a paso controlado por motor - Motor paso a paso como codificador rotatorio: 11 pasos (con imágenes)
Motor paso a paso controlado por motor paso a paso | Motor paso a paso como codificador rotatorio: ¿Tiene un par de motores paso a paso por ahí y quiere hacer algo? En este Instructable, usemos un motor paso a paso como codificador rotatorio para controlar la posición de otro motor paso a paso usando un microcontrolador Arduino. Así que sin más preámbulos, vamos a
Cómo usar el motor paso a paso como codificador rotatorio y pantalla OLED para pasos: 6 pasos
Cómo usar el motor paso a paso como codificador rotatorio y pantalla OLED para pasos: En este tutorial aprenderemos cómo rastrear los pasos del motor paso a paso en la pantalla OLED. Mire un video de demostración. El crédito para el tutorial original es para el usuario de YouTube " sky4fly "